Management software install problem - PLEASE HELP!!
Please help!!
I'll outline the series of events, and the question will follow:
I intended to install all the Compaq management agents etc onto our new server; however, the management CD was lost. I went to the Compaq website and downloaded the latest version of IM and some other agents such as power management, system drivers etc.
I installed the latest version of IM and also installed Compaq System Management Driver v3.31.1.1 . These both installed fine.
Now the CD was found, and I decided to start again from scratch. I uninstalled IM, and deleted any files and directories I could see that related to Compaq management.
Following the instructions, using the management CD, I installed IM successfully, configured it along with SNMP etc, and then went to install the Compaq Management Agents for Servers. At this point I get an error message:
"You cannot install the current version of the Agents because you have an unsupported version installed. Please uninstall your current version using the setup program that was used for the installation."
I then uninstalled IM, and deleted any files and directories I could see that related to Compaq management, rebooted and tried again. This time, I tried to install Compaq Management Agents for Servers first. Still I get the error message:
"You cannot install the current version of the Agents because you have an unsupported version installed. Please uninstall your current version using the setup program that was used for the installation."
There are no Compaq programs in ADD/REMOVE programs. There are no Compaq uninstall exes I can see - or any Compaq directories at all I can see in fact.
Could anyone offer any helpful suggestions on how I can get rid of this error message so I can install the Management applications?

Re: Management software install problem - PLEASE HELP!!
On the www.compaq.com/windows2000 site, there is a utility called 'primer.exe' - it removes all Compaq specific drivers/utilities in preparation for a Windows 2000 install - BUT - you can use it to recover from software glitches like you've run across... if the problem persists email us at support@compaq.com or call 1-800-ok-compaq
